Name: Segetibacter koreensis An et al. 2007
Etymology: ko.re.en’sis. N.L. masc. adj. koreensis, of Korea, from where the novel organism was isolated
Pronunciation, gender: … ko-re-EN-sis, masculine
Type strain: DSM 18137; Gsoil 664; KCTC 12655

Valid publication:
An DS, Lee HG, Im WT, Liu QM, Lee ST. Segetibacter koreensis gen. nov., sp. nov., a novel member of the phylum Bacteroidetes, isolated from the soil of a ginseng field in South Korea.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2007; 57:1828-1833.

Nomenclatural status: validly published under the ICNP
Taxonomic status: correct name
Parent taxon: Segetibacter An et al. 2007
